Chapter 2 - A New partnership and Unlikely trust

Seeds of Trust and Ambition

The following morning, Rose invited a reputable merchant to her mansion, a man known for his honesty and skill in the empire's bustling business world. Alongside him was a talented designer she had arranged to meet, both eager to hear the young lady's ambitious proposal.

With a calm, composed expression, Rose spread her neatly drawn jewelry designs and elegant clothing sketches before them. The merchant's eyes sparkled with curiosity, while the designer's gaze was fixed on the details of her work.

"I wish to open a jewelry and clothing shop," Rose stated confidently. "You will be responsible for manufacturing these designs, but only under the conditions I set. The quality must be impeccable."

The merchant nodded, impressed by her precision.

"Lady Celestia, your designs are truly exquisite. I can assure you of my loyalty and dedication. We shall bring your vision to life."

The designer, equally impressed, added, "I have never seen such intricate and graceful designs before. I would be honored to work under your guidance."

A contract was sealed that day. As the merchant and designer left the mansion, Rose couldn't help but feel relieved.

"Everything is progressing smoothly. As long as their loyalty remains true, my shops will soon thrive."

The next day marked the grand opening of her shops. The merchant and designer were present, reaffirming their dedication to their work. Rose rewarded their loyalty with generous payments, promising even more if they continued to meet her standards.

But something lingered at the back of her mind—managing two shops alone would be overwhelming. She needed reliable support.

Without hesitation, Rose summoned her assistant, her lady-in-waiting, Lily Advent.

Lily, a humble commoner with gentle eyes and a calm demeanor, entered the room with a respectful bow. Despite her composed appearance, Rose noticed the tension in her gaze.

"Lily," Rose began, her tone both commanding and reassuring. "I require your assistance. Managing the shops will be impossible on my own. I need someone I can trust by my side."

"M-My Lady?" Lily stammered, her voice laced with surprise. "You... You trust me with something so important?"

"Yes, I do," Rose replied firmly. "But before we proceed, tell me about your family. You seem to be carrying a heavy burden."

Lily hesitated, her fingers nervously twisting the fabric of her dress. "My family... It's just me, my sick younger brother, and my mother. My father passed away from an illness when I was a child. We've been struggling ever since."

"I see." Rose's expression softened. "You must have gone through a lot. And yet, you continue to work with such dedication."

"I cannot afford to fail," Lily admitted, her eyes filled with determination. "I need to support my family, and I cannot let personal matters affect my duties. I will work hard and never betray your trust."

Rose smiled gently.

"Good. From now on, you will be responsible for organizing the shops. Hiring workers, maintaining accounts, everything. You will also accompany me to social gatherings and palace banquets."

Lily's eyes widened. "Palace banquets?"

"Yes," Rose continued, her gaze sharp. "You need to gain experience as my lady-in-waiting, and I need someone reliable by my side to help me form connections. Also, it will be a good opportunity for you to find skilled workers for the shops."

"...I understand, My Lady." Lily's voice trembled with a mixture of fear and gratitude. "I promise I will not disappoint you. You have my loyalty."

"And you have my support," Rose replied. "Don't worry about your brother's health. I will make sure he receives proper treatment. Your loyalty will be rewarded, Lily."

Lily's eyes welled up with tears, but she kept her composure and bowed deeply.

"Thank you, Lady Celestia. I will serve you with all my heart."

As Lily left the room, Rose leaned back in her chair, feeling a sense of accomplishment.

"I now have the support I need. With Lily's help, I can manage the shops while also navigating the complicated social circles of this world. One step at a time, I will secure a peaceful future for myself."

But as Rose's ambitions grew, so did the unseen shadows waiting to disrupt her plans.
